Direct Flights and Their Availability

Flight options from LAX to Mauritius vary depending on the airline and season. Currently, there are no direct flights available between Los Angeles International Airport (LAX) and Mauritius. Travelers typically need to take connecting flights through major hubs in Europe, the Middle East, or Asia. The availability of flights can fluctuate, with some routes offering one-stop options via airlines such as Air France, Emirates, or Turkish Airlines. It is advisable to check with airlines and travel agencies for the latest schedules and availability before planning your trip to Mauritius from LAX.

Average Flight Duration

The travel duration from Los Angeles (LAX) to Mauritius varies depending on the route and layovers. Typically, the average flight duration for this long-haul journey ranges between 20 to 24 hours, including transfer times.

  • One-stop flights usually take around 20 to 22 hours, with layovers in cities such as Doha, Istanbul, or Dubai.
  • Flights with two stopovers can extend the total travel time up to 24 hours or more.
  • The actual flight time from LAX to the connecting hubs is approximately 14 to 16 hours, depending on the airline and route.
  • Followed by a shorter flight of about 6 to 8 hours from the hub to Mauritius.

It’s important to check current airline schedules as travel times can vary due to seasonal adjustments and airline policies. Planning ahead helps ensure a smoother journey to this tropical paradise.

Seasonal Variations in Flight Schedules

The travel duration and timing from LAX to Mauritius can vary significantly depending on the time of year and the airline chosen. Understanding seasonal variations in flight schedules is essential for travelers aiming to optimize their journey and arrive comfortably and punctually.

  • Flight durations typically range from 20 to 24 hours, including layovers, with most routes involving at least one connection, often in Middle Eastern or European hubs.
  • Seasonal differences influence flight frequency and timing; during peak seasons like winter holidays and summer months, airlines may offer more flights, sometimes with shorter layovers.
  • Off-peak seasons may see fewer flights, potentially leading to longer travel times due to extended layovers or less direct routing.
  • Weather conditions, especially during the cyclone season from January to March in Mauritius, can affect flight schedules, causing delays or cancellations.
  • Advanced planning and checking seasonal schedule updates are recommended to secure the most convenient and timely flights from LAX to Mauritius.

Best Time to Book for Lower Fares

Planning a trip from Los Angeles to Mauritius can be exciting, and timing your booking can help you save money. To find the best fares, it is recommended to start searching for flights at least two to three months in advance. Booking during the shoulder seasons, such as April to June or September to November, often offers more affordable options as demand is lower. Avoid peak travel periods like major holidays and school vacation times, which tend to have higher prices. Monitoring prices regularly and setting fare alerts can also help you catch any sudden drops in prices. Additionally, being flexible with your travel dates and considering connecting flights can further reduce your transportation costs, making your trip to Mauritius more budget-friendly.

Airports and Transfer Options

Traveling from LAX to Mauritius offers a variety of arrival and transportation options to ensure a smooth journey upon reaching the island. Understanding the airports and transfer methods available can help make your trip more convenient and enjoyable.

Airports in Mauritius

The main international gateway to Mauritius is Sir Seewoosagur Ramgoolam International Airport (MRU), located near the capital city of Port Louis. It is a modern facility handling numerous international flights and providing essential amenities for travelers.

Transfer Options from the Airport

  • Taxi Services: Official airport taxis are available 24/7 for direct transfer to hotels or other destinations. These are reliable and can be booked in advance or upon arrival.
  • Car Rentals: Several car rental agencies operate at the airport, offering a range of vehicles for self-drive options around the island.
  • Pre-Arranged Transfers: Many hotels and tour operators provide private or shared transfer services, which can be booked prior to your flight for added convenience.

Overall, Mauritius’s well-equipped airport and diverse transportation methods ensure that visitors arriving from LAX or elsewhere can easily access their accommodations and explore the beautiful island scenery with ease.
